There are many possible reasons your corn plant is dying; The process involves first identifying what is causing your corn plant to show symptoms of dying, and how severe the problem actually is. In this article, we will discuss the most common corn plant pests and how to identify and treat them. Some signs that indicate a dying corn plant include yellowing or browning of leaves, wilting, stunted growth, and root rot. Several diseases can affect corn plants, including southern corn leaf blight, gray leaf spot, and common rust. It’s important to inspect the plant regularly and look for these symptoms.
